About CCHI
The Colorado Consumer Health Initiative (CCHI) is a nonprofit, consumer-oriented, membership-based health advocacy organization that serves Coloradans whose access to health care and financial security are compromised by structural barriers, affordability, poor benefits, or unfair business practices of the healthcare industry.
Identifying a Need in Colorado
Before our Consumer Assistance Program was founded, CCHI received calls from individuals who needed advice about which insurance provided the best coverage for health services or help with medical bills. In fielding these calls, we discovered a gap in organizations providing (or sustaining the institutional knowledge to provide) medical insurance and medical bill navigation.
The Consumer Assistance Program is Born
In June 2018, with funding from Next 50 Initiative, CCHI founded a Consumer Assistance Program (CAP) that helps individual consumers navigate medical billing, claims and access to care issues, and prescription drug costs. In addition to providing direct assistance to individual consumers, CAP informs CCHI’s policy and regulatory advocacy by surfacing issues consumers face on a daily basis. This helps us to identify emerging concerns and potential policy changes.
Since its inception, as of November 2021, CAP has served 1,583 people in 45 counties, and saved them over $4.2 million. CAP staffing includes: a manager, one coordinators, a fellow, and three volunteers who each work approximately 8 hours per week. To-date, we are the only program operating statewide that provides these kinds of services to Coloradans who need them.
How the Consumer Assistance Program is Funded
You will never be charged for our services.
CCHI’s Consumer Assistance program (CAP) has been funded by a grant from Next Fifty Initiative, the founding funder of our program, through November 30, 2021. CAP is also supported by sponsorships and donations. Colorado Access is our current sponsor and AARP has also sponsored the CAP in past years.
